And now for the snow...


North American Weather Consultants (NAWC) has conducted operational winter cloud seed-ing programs in many of the mountainous areas of Utah since 1974. The goal of these programs has been to enhance winter snowpack accumulation in several mountainous target areas throughout the State. Studies have demonstrated that a large majority of the annual runoff in Utah streams and rivers is derived from melting snowpacks, which explains the focus on wintertime seeding. Augmented water supplies are typically used for irrigated agriculture or municipal water supplies. Programs are typically funded at the county level with cost-sharing grants from the Utah Division of Water Resources.

Weather Modification, Inc./Solutions for the Ground

Weather Modification, Inc., offers specially designed and manufactured solutions to meet the specific challenges of ground-based cloud seeding. Both incorporate the latest in ground-based pyrotechnic applications, and are self-contained. When controlled via satellite, they can be sited virtually anywhere.


Ground-Based Flare Tree Cost-effective, simple to maintain and easy to install, the ground-based flare tree, or GBFT, comes in two versions to accommodate different flare types: glaciogenic (108 flares) and hygroscopic (60 flares). All designs offer remote, real-time control of the system, utilizing cellular/satellite technology in conjunction with microprocessor technology.

I understand that ground based 'cannons' are used for cloud seeding quite a lot by winter resorts in the US - and obviously being able to trigger them by cell phone makes sense as it avoids needed to send someone up to the hill top (where they are usually situated) to fire them.

ie Cloud seeding aims to increase Winter Park snowfall

I think the weather in the UK is usually too dynamic for cloud seeding to really be much use (assuming it actually works at all* - there's still a lot of debate over this, though obviously firms selling the technology will make grandious claims than many meteorologists may disagree with
) - weather systems tend to push through very quickly over our small island.
